No, but the youtube demos look fantastic.

Clean multi-mode delay + simultaneous reverb, 4 user presets, seems to be capable of self-oscillation, and going for a very reasonable price.

i had one for a few days and i gonna buy it next month. just simple delay and reverb with presets and 12 second looper. modulated reverb was noisy but anything else is fine.
